Why Brine Bags for Turkey Are Necessary

I’ve found that brine bags are necessary because they make the whole turkey brining process much easier and cleaner. When I use a brine bag, I don’t have to worry about spills, leaks, or trying to fit a large bird into a messy container. The bag holds the turkey and the brine together securely, which helps me save time and avoid a lot of cleanup.

I also like that brine bags help the turkey stay fully submerged in the brine. In my experience, this is important because even soaking means the meat absorbs more flavor and moisture. That usually gives me a juicier turkey with better texture, especially after roasting.

Another reason I rely on brine bags is convenience. My fridge space is limited, and a bag takes up less room than a big bucket or pot. For me, that makes brining far more practical, especially during holidays when I’m already juggling a lot in the kitchen.

What I Look for in a Brine Bag

When I shop for a brine bag, I pay attention to a few important things. First, I make sure the bag is large enough to fit my turkey comfortably along with the brine solution. I also check that the material is strong and food-safe, since I do not want it tearing during brining. Another thing I always consider is whether the bag has a reliable seal or closure, because that helps prevent messy leaks.

Size and Capacity Matter Most

From my experience, size is one of the most important features. If the bag is too small, the turkey will not brine properly, and I may end up with a mess. I usually choose a bag that clearly states the turkey size it can handle, such as up to 15 pounds or 25 pounds. I always prefer a little extra room rather than a bag that fits too tightly.

Material Quality and Durability

I never want to risk a bag splitting halfway through brining, so I look for thick, durable plastic that feels dependable. A strong bag gives me peace of mind, especially when I am using a heavy turkey and a large amount of liquid. I also prefer bags that are designed specifically for brining or food storage, since they are usually made with safety and strength in mind.

Leak Resistance Is Essential

In my kitchen, leak resistance is non-negotiable. A brine bag should hold liquid securely without dripping all over the refrigerator or counter. I look for double-seal closures, tie systems, or heavy-duty zip seals because they help me feel confident that the brine will stay inside the bag where it belongs.

Ease of Use and Cleanup

I like products that make my life easier, and brine bags are no exception. A good bag should be easy to fill, seal, and move without needing extra help. I also appreciate bags that can be disposed of quickly after use, since cleanup is much simpler than scrubbing a large container.

Food Safety Features I Never Ignore

Since the bag will hold raw turkey and liquid for hours, I always make sure it is food-safe and BPA-free if possible. I do not want any questionable materials touching my food. For me, choosing a trusted food-safe brine bag is one of the best ways to keep the brining process safe and stress-free.
